Pickett, WI Local Guide

Largest Available Pickett and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Pickett, WI is found at River Place Apartments and is 1,258 square feet priced from $1,800. The Wit has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,180 square feet and currently listed start at $1,900.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in Pickett:

Cheapest Available Pickett and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of June 11, 2026 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Pickett, WI is the 2 Bed 2 Bath A Model starting from $715 at The Annex of Oshkosh in the Downtown Oshkosh neighborhood. The second most affordable Pickett 2 Bedroom is the 2240 Bldg - 2Bed - 1Bath Model at Cedar Creek Apartments starting at $875 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Pickett is currently $1,360.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Pickett:
